No matter if you're buying new or used it's crucial to make sure the safety of your cot prior to allowing your baby cot online (click homepage) to sleep in it. Look for a certificate of compliance from the manufacturer, along with detailed labels and warnings. It should also be free from sharp edges, protrusions, or gaps that could trap a child's finger or leg. Additionally, there should be no footholds in the cot children could use to climb out.

When selecting a cot, make sure the mattress is flat and clean. It should fit perfectly with no gaps. The bottom edge of the lowest rail should not be higher than 30mm from the base of the mattress. If the cot has an adjustable base, be sure that it is in the lowest position.

Verify that the slats as well as filler bars have been firmly secured, and aren't brimming with tiny holes that could trap clothing. Bolts, nuts, and corner posts shouldn't extend more than 5mm to stop a child from being able to catch their fingers. Make sure the cot bed sales is not near drapes or blinds that are loose and can easily be pulled off by tiny hands.

Lastly check for a certificate which indicates that the cot has been tested to the standards required by law and is in compliance with Australian Standards AS/NZS 2172:2003 Cots for safety requirements for use in the home. This is the only way to make sure that the cot you are purchasing is safe and suitable for sleeping. It is against the law for antique stores, retailers and second-hand shops to offer antique cots without labels or certificates.
